glossary-header-desktop

Projektowanie i rozwój oprogramowania Słownik

W dzisiejszych czasach istnieje akronim dla wszystkiego. Przeglądaj nasz słownik projektowania i rozwoju oprogramowania, aby znaleźć definicję dla tych uciążliwych terminów branżowych.

Back to Knowledge Base

Glossary
Najlepszy język do uczenia maszynowego
Najlepszy język do uczenia maszynowego odnosi się do języka programowania, który jest najbardziej odpowiedni do efektywnego i wydajnego budowania oraz wdrażania modeli uczenia maszynowego.

W przypadku uczenia maszynowego istnieje kilka języków programowania, które są powszechnie używane, każdy z nich ma swoje mocne i słabe strony. Jednym z najpopularniejszych języków do uczenia maszynowego jest Python.

Python jest znany ze swojej prostoty i czytelności, co czyni go idealnym wyborem dla początkujących i doświadczonych programistów.

Posiada również szeroki zakres bibliotek i frameworków, które zostały specjalnie zaprojektowane do uczenia maszynowego, takich jak TensorFlow, Keras i scikit-learn, co ułatwia wdrażanie złożonych algorytmów i modeli. Innym językiem, który jest powszechnie używany do uczenia maszynowego, jest R.

R jest językiem specjalnie zaprojektowanym do obliczeń statystycznych i grafiki, co czyni go potężnym narzędziem do analizy danych i wizualizacji.

Ma również dużą liczbę pakietów i bibliotek, które są szczególnie dostosowane do uczenia maszynowego, co czyni go popularnym wyborem wśród statystyków i naukowców zajmujących się danymi. Oprócz Pythona i R, inne języki, takie jak Java, C++ i Julia, są również używane do uczenia maszynowego, każdy z nich ma swoje zalety i wady.

Java, na przykład, jest znana ze swojej szybkości i skalowalności, co czyni ją dobrym wyborem do budowania systemów uczenia maszynowego o dużej skali.

C++ jest również znany ze swojej szybkości i efektywności, co czyni go popularnym wyborem do wdrażania algorytmów uczenia maszynowego o wysokiej wydajności. Ostatecznie najlepszy język do uczenia maszynowego będzie zależał od specyficznych wymagań projektu i doświadczenia zespołu.

Ważne jest, aby uwzględnić czynniki takie jak łatwość użycia, wydajność, skalowalność oraz dostępność bibliotek i frameworków przy wyborze języka do uczenia maszynowego.

Wybierając odpowiedni język do zadania, deweloperzy mogą zapewnić, że ich projekty uczenia maszynowego będą udane i efektywne.

Może to początek pięknej przyjaźni?

Jesteśmy dostępni dla nowych projektów.

Contact us